Game News and Updates Demo Hotfix 7 is out!
Patch notes:
- You can now phase through buildings while hovering in the air.
- The people have spoken. An overwhelming majority (88%) voted in favor. I personally think the challenge/puzzle of designing a traversable factory is interesting but also very frustrating.
- For those who still want to play the old way there's now a "Hard Mode" setting.
- Snow now vaporizes into Steam when burned.
- Queued buildings now block Water, and you can grab Water that is inside them.
- Dragging a button onto itself now clicks it instead of canceling.
- This was a big reason the buttons felt "hard" to click.
- You can no longer zip by placing blocks on top of yourself in rectangular mode.
- You can no longer build outside the map in the other dimensions.
- Added some fixes to the sound engine to mitigate crashes when too many sounds play at once (let me know if it still happens!).
- Many lighting improvements to reduce flickering.
- Water no longer deletes Lava.
- You can now grab particles that are being launched (including ones stuck inside launchers).
- You can now grab Steam.
- Added some fixes for the "no menu buttons" issue due to corrupted meta data.
- Still haven't figured out the root cause though.
- Fixed a bug that deleted Gold when the Shaker was full.
- New saves will now have much more Redsand on the map.
- Refined and clarified many tutorial texts. Also added a new "Tutorial Finished" popup.
- Fixed bugs causing issues when pressing "Skip Tutorial" after partially completing it.
- The Grabber's Material Scanner upgrade now says "Interacts with:" to clarify what the emojis represent.
- Some people on Linux have reported that emojis are not showing.
- Added damage type indicator to all weapon descriptions matching the interaction texts.
- Added interaction text to Steam and Cinder.
- Updated some item descriptions for clarity.
